Aviation Australia will hold its annual Aviation Careers Expo at its Brisbane Airport facilities on August 24.
Now in its 13th year, the Expo is recognised as one of the major events on the Queensland aviation calendar, offering an opportunity for students, graduates, teachers, parents and those seeking a career change to explore the diverse range of career pathways available in the aviation and aerospace industries.

Also coinciding with the Expo, Aviation High will be holding an open day in Clayfield, between 1000 and 1400. The unique school focuses on aerospace related education for Year 8 to Year 12 students passionate about aviation and aerospace and considering careers in these areas.
Aviation enthusiasts, meanwhile, can visit a static aircraft display to be mounted specially for the day.
The Aviation Careers Expo will run from 1000 to 1600 at 25 Boronia Road at Brisbane Airport.
